Technology description
Purchased yellow phosphorus is packaged in iron drums. The phosphorus is pumped from the drums into the water seal of a phosphorus storage tank and melted using steam or hot water. The molten phosphorus is then transferred to a melting tank, where it is forced through nozzles at the top of a specialized combustion furnace by the pressure of an elevated water supply, while dry compressed air is simultaneously injected into the nozzles. Inside the furnace, the liquid phosphorus and dry air undergo complete combustion to produce phosphorus pentoxide (P₂O₅) gas. The resulting gas mixture exits the furnace at approximately 250°C and enters a hydration tower. There, it contacts circulating cold phosphoric acid in a co-current flow to facilitate absorption and hydration, while simultaneously dissipating a large amount of heat. As the circulating acid absorbs the P₂O₅ gas, its concentration and temperature continuously rise. Consequently, the acid is cooled in a plate heat exchanger after exiting the hydration tower and then recirculated. Through this continuous cycle, the acid gradually reaches the target concentration of 85% industrial phosphoric acid.
